The Manufacture of Railway Locomotives and Rolling Stock report lists domestic locomotive and rolling stock acquisitions to date, examines current conditions and describes capacity expansion programmes. Also covered are regulatory issues, developments in the rest of Africa and factors influencing the success of the local manufacturing sector. The report profiles 34 companies, including Gibela Rail Transport Consortium (RF) (Pty) Ltd, a joint venture between Alstom Southern Africa Holdings, Ubumbano Rail and New Africa Rail, and CSR E-Loco Supply (Pty) Ltd, the South African subsidiary of China’s CRRC Zhuzhou Locomotive. Also profiled is SMME, CNR Rolling Stock South Africa (Pty) Ltd, which is involved in the design, manufacture, testing, commissioning and maintenance of locomotives and rolling stock. A list of local manufacturers and suppliers of specialised systems and components to the rail manufacturing industry is included in the Appendix of this detailed report.
The Manufacture of Railway Locomotives and Rolling Stock
The railway locomotive and rolling stock manufacturing industry is part of the drive to revitalise the rail industry as a whole, and includes locomotive and rolling stock acquisition programmes by Transnet to the value of R51bn, by the Passenger Rail Association of South Africa (Prasa) valued at R123.5bn, and the proposed expansion programme of the Gautrain Management Agency estimated at R4.3bn.
Local Content Designation
The locomotive and rolling stock acquisition contracts have been awarded to consortiums and joint ventures consisting of global original equipment manufacturers (OEMs), local OEMs and empowerment partners. Successful OEMs are faced with the challenge of contractual obligations which include an average 65% local content, the establishment or expansion of local manufacturing facilities, the development of a core of skilled technical staff thereby ensuring technology transfer, and the creation of a sustainable value chain of local manufacturers and suppliers. Since July 2016 specific minimum threshold percentages for local production and content for the different classes of rail rolling stock have been adapted and range from 55% for diesel locomotives to 80% for Wagons.
